Palomo, Francisco de Borja (1822-1898)Other forms
Estepona (Málaga, España) 1822 - Sevilla (España) 1898-05-10 (En la Biografía del Diccionario de catedráticos españoles de Derecho (1847-1943) [UC3M] se indica que nació en 1884)
He was a Spanish professor of Law who was married with Catalina Ruiz Digueri.
He studied the baccalaureate in Jurisprudence and graduated in Jurisprudence in 1843, obtaining the doctorate from the Universidad de Sevilla in 1845.
Professor of History and Elements of Roman Law of the Universidad de Sevilla in 1865. Secretary of the Faculty of Law of the said University in 1862 and in 1875. Vice secretary of the Faculty of Law in 1869.
Other positions he held were:
Member of the Real Academia de la Historia. Sub director of the Monte de Piedad and Caja de Ahorros de Sevilla. Trustee of the City Mayor of Seville since 1856 until 1864.
